Transaction c499511490b928dcd754aa656c8474f25cbc1152e050b2e707bfd82ff245b689

1 Input
2 Outputs
  • c499511490b928dcd754aa656c8474f25cbc1152e050b2e707bfd82ff245b689:0
  • value  17560066503
    address  17eCUDNDXCqL5TaPMZB1r67mCSMG4MZ4zb
  • c499511490b928dcd754aa656c8474f25cbc1152e050b2e707bfd82ff245b689:1
  • value  97980000
    address  14hqjQwbHMT3L32Umb5dcfqB37iYv7Y9Yp